If you're ready to apply cutting-edge technology to solve meaningful problems alongside a talented team—we'd love to have you join us.About the role: Bedrock is building autonomous construction robots that operate in some of the most unstructured, high-stakes environments on earth. To do that, we need machines that deeply understand the built world - and that starts with data.The Data Understanding Program is the backbone of how we annotate, search, and explore the robot data that powers our autonomy stack. As an Agentic Data Understanding Engineer, you will design and build the AI-driven systems that automatically generate high-quality annotations at scale: the auto-labelers, orchestration pipelines, quality harnesses, and agentic workflows that allow Bedrock to move from raw sensor data to structured, semantically rich annotations - quickly, cheaply, and reliably.This role sits at the intersection of applied ML, data infrastructure, and robotics, and will directly shape how fast Bedrock can expand its operational domain.
